Understanding Met Éireann Cork: Ireland’s Meteorological Service
Met Éireann Cork, established in 1936, is responsible for monitoring and forecasting weather and climate conditions across Ireland. The agency plays a critical role in delivering accurate weather forecasts, issuing warnings for extreme weather events, and providing climate data for research and decision-making.It is a member of the World Meteorological Organization (WMO) and participates in various collaborative networks to ensure the precision and reliability of its forecasting systems.The headquarters of is located in Glasnevin, Dublin, but it has regional offices, including one in Cork. The Cork office plays a key role in gathering weather data specific to the southern region, analyzing it, and providing localized forecasts for Cork and its surrounding areas.

The Role of the Met Éireann Cork Office
Cork’s geographical location, nestled along the southern coast of Ireland, presents unique weather challenges. With its proximity to the Atlantic Ocean, Cork experiences a wide range of weather conditions, including strong winds, heavy rainfall, and occasional storms. Understanding the intricacies of local weather patterns is vital for accurate forecasting, and this is where Met Éireann’s Cork office plays a crucial role.
Collecting Localized Weather Data
The Cork office collects weather data through various meteorological instruments and tools, including weather stations, radar systems, and satellite imagery. This data is used to assess current conditions and forecast future weather patterns for the region. Local weather stations are particularly important for measuring parameters like temperature, humidity, wind speed, and rainfall, which can vary significantly across different parts of Cork.In addition to ground-based data collection, Met Éireann uses advanced technology such as weather radars and weather balloons. The Cork office is responsible for interpreting this data and providing timely, localized forecasts to the public.

Severe Weather Warnings and Public Safety
In addition to routine weather forecasting, Met Éireann issues warnings for severe weather events that may pose a risk to public safety. These warnings are crucial in ensuring that individuals, businesses, and authorities take necessary precautions in the face of extreme weather conditions such as storms, flooding, or snow.For Cork, the proximity to the Atlantic Ocean makes the region vulnerable to various extreme weather events, including storms and heavy rainfall. Met Éireann Cork office is at the forefront of monitoring such events, providing early warnings for any conditions that could lead to dangerous situations. The warnings can include alerts for high winds, flooding, and low temperatures, helping to reduce the risk of damage and injury.During significant weather events, Met Éireann Cork works closely with local authorities to disseminate warnings and assist with emergency planning. This collaboration is particularly important during events like the winter storms that occasionally impact Cork, bringing icy conditions and snow that can disrupt transport and daily life.

Agriculture: Planning for Crop Production
Cork is a major agricultural hub in Ireland, with a focus on dairy farming, crop production, and horticulture. Farmers in the region rely heavily on weather forecasts to plan their activities and ensure the success of their crops. Accurate data on rainfall, temperature, and frost risk helps farmers make informed decisions about planting, irrigation, and harvesting.During unpredictable weather events, such as extended dry spells or unseasonably cold temperatures, Met Éireann Cork alerts help farmers protect their crops. For example, early warnings of frost or drought allow farmers to take measures to shield their plants or adapt their irrigation schedules.
